At Orchardline we pin every direct dependency to an exact version — no ranges, no wildcards. This applies to all services in the Tanglewood monorepo, including test-only packages. Updates happen through the weekly Pinwright sweep, which opens batched upgrade requests reviewed by the platform group. Never bump a pin inside a feature branch; it complicates rollback and muddies the audit trail. Exceptions require written sign-off from a maintainer. The complete policy, including the emergency-patch process, is documented here:

runbook for kawef-hahif: https://jira.lumicsys.internal/projects/browse/display/c08d703c

## Ticket: Signature verification failing on Checkwright validator plugins

Since Tuesday's deploy, the Checkwright plugin loader rejects the `postal-rules` and `iban-strict` validators with a signature mismatch. Root cause appears to be the registry serving bundles signed with the retired key while the loader only trusts the current one. Pell has re-signed both bundles; verification passes in staging. For the sync: loaders must pin the key below, not the retired one.

deploy key for bawig-tajop: bky9_PQ3GVoQw1

Pre-2.3, the FX module rounded at each intermediate hop, accumulating off-by-one-cent errors on multi-leg conversions. The new pipeline rounds once, at settlement, using banker's rounding. Verify ledger parity against the Quorvane reconciliation job before promoting to production — any mismatch over 0.5% blocks the release. No data backfill needed; historical entries keep legacy rounding. Apply the updated settings to the conversion service before restarting. The values below replace the entire rounding section of the config.

service settings:
feneth:
  pin: 7099
  tenant: aldvan
  seal: seal_b296c631
  metrics_host: metrics.feneth.novactech.internal
  standby_team: tamax
  escalation: gorael-casok
  nonce: a02f99